Talbot Flushed Away By Rudolph

Level 10 : Blinds 600/1,200, 1,200 ante
Parker Talbot
Parker Talbot

With most of the chips already in preflop, the last 3,700 of Parker Talbot went in after the {k-Hearts}{q-Spades}{j-Diamonds} flop. He was called by Christian Rudolph and both revealed one card after the other while the TV crew was recording the showdown.

Parker Talbot: {a-Clubs}{4-Hearts}
Christian Rudolph: {j-Hearts}{8-Hearts}

The paired jack had Rudolph ahead but Talbot improved with the {a-Hearts} turn. However, another twist to the story followed as the {3-Hearts} river improved Rudolph to a winning flush.
